Madeley High School is seeking a dedicated Teacher of Science (Physics) to join their collaborative Science department. The ideal candidate will deliver high-quality lessons across various age groups and be committed to professional development. The school boasts a track record of exceptional results. Join a vibrant culture of excellence, where collaboration and initiative are highly valued. The successful candidate will benefit from a supportive environment and numerous CPD opportunities.

How to prepare for a job interview at Madeley High School

Know Your Physics Inside Out

Make sure you brush up on key physics concepts and teaching methods. Be prepared to discuss how you would explain complex topics to different age groups, as this will show your understanding of the subject and your ability to engage students.

Showcase Your Teaching Style

Think about how you can demonstrate your teaching style during the interview. Prepare a mini-lesson or an example of a lesson plan that highlights your creativity and ability to make physics fun and accessible for all students.

Emphasise Collaboration

Since Madeley High School values collaboration, be ready to share examples of how you've worked with colleagues in the past. Discuss any team projects or initiatives you've been part of, and how they contributed to a positive learning environment.

Highlight Your Commitment to Professional Development

The school offers numerous CPD opportunities, so it's important to express your eagerness to grow as an educator. Talk about any courses, workshops, or training you've undertaken, and how you plan to continue developing your skills in the future.
